Package: android-udev-rules Version: Wrong version number on break/replaces g-a-plaform-tools-installer Severity: important
Dear Maintainer, While trying to upgrade your package to revision (0~20250314+ds-4), it appears that it wrongly breaks/replaces "google-android-platform-tools-installer". The current version of the binary package google-android-platform-tools- installer is 35.0.2+1743526702-1 and not 1743526702-1.
